I'm using Red Hat Enterprise Linux 7 and I'm facing problems when try to enable security authorization on my MongoDB 3.2 configuration.
When I start the service system shows following error:
# systemctl start mongod Job for mongod.service failed. See 'systemctl status mongod.service' and 'journalctl -xn' for details.
# cat mongod.conf
systemLog:
destination: file
logAppend: true
path: /var/log/mongodb/mongod.log
storage:
dbPath: /var/lib/mongo
journal:
enabled: true
engine: wiredTiger
processManagement:
fork: true # fork and run in background
pidFilePath: /var/run/mongodb/mongod.pid # location of pidfile
net:
port: 27017
security:
authorization: enable
